Prime Minister Ingrida Šimonytė extends greetings to Latvia and its people celebrating their Independence Day, coupled with best wishes for prosperity and well-being.

‘The celebration of Latvia’s Independence is an inspiring reminder for many nations around the world how much a free and democratic country can achieve.

This is a special day for Lithuania as well, as Lithuanians and Latvians are brotherly nations, close friends and allies, whose destinies are intertwined. I have no doubt that we will continue strengthening our friendly relations and cooperation and successfully overcome today's challenges by continuing to act together.

The experience and unity of the Baltic States is very important in building peaceful, prosperous, and strong Europe which is not susceptible to aggressors’ blackmail. Our continued unity in supporting Ukraine and in strengthening the sanctions against Russia and Belarus are of utmost importance as we seek sustainable peace in our continent.

As we focus our efforts on security and peace, I also hope that our two nations will continue to expand bilateral cooperation, especially in the fields of business, education, culture, people-to-people contacts’, reads Prime Minister’s message of greetings to Prime Minister of Latvia Krišjānis Kariņš.
